Jelenia góra is full of Character, the buildings are dated and well built.a completely safe area to visit,the locals go out there way to welcome visitors and there's always something interesting to do or see,plenty of restaurants, bars,eateries to suit every taste,all reasonably priced, jelenia góra is a gem.

Jelenia goes is a nice small city. If you want a nice quiet place to spend time with your spouse and or family it is perfect. Swim at the city pool. Go to see time gates it's a crazy history lesson that is fun. Walk in the old town and enjoy reasonably priced meals, drinks, and deserts. Biking and hiking trails and parks nearby. We speak English and German. It was not as easy to get by as the bigger cities but way less money. Probably not a good place to come party. I didn't see many clubs. Shops close about 8 pm

From Jelenia Góra valley, located in the middle of the mountains from Lower Silesia (Dolny Sląsk), one can admire impressive views over the surrounding mountain tops but also enjoy beautiful small cities. Cieplice is a charming district of Jelenia Gora, were you can enjoy Termy Cieplice ( Cieplice Termal Baths). The complex has several outdoor and indoor pools for swimming or relaxation and a spa area. Also the area of Cieplice is quite pretty to wander around as well since it’s filled with beautiful buildings built by the Schaffgotsch family in the 1700s. There is also a big and nice English garden (Park Zdrojowy) opened much of it to the public. Cieplice is also a great place to explore the the Karkonosze or Giant Mountains National Park. The Kopa Chairlift (Kolej linowa na Kopę) is about 30 minutes drive distance. From the Top Station you can climb the 1602 high Sněžka. (it is advisable to take warmer clothes to Sněžka as the temperature up can be more than 10C lower than at the village of Karpacz). Also you can visit the central city of Jelenia Gora with a great Old Town. If you have time and a car you can visit also Pałac Wojanów (20 minutes drive) or make a trip to the biggest Silesian castle: Książ Castle near Wałbrzych (one hour drive). Or if your stay is more than a week you can visit Wroclaw, one of the most charming cities of Poland.
